There are lots of ways you can learn more about technology-infused PBL without taking a traditional university course. Each of the resources suggested in this article provides more in-depth learning opportunities for teachers than this short column could hope to provide. The opportunities are divided into types of material: books and Web sites, multimedia, conferences, and coaching/tutoring. Each resource is annotated so that you will have some idea whether it is one you would like to pursue. In fact, because most of these resources are free, you can mix and match segments of the various opportunities to build your own course of self-study.
